Coloring tips: How to color Freddy Fazbear At Carnival coloring page well?
Start with Freddy's classic brown fur and use a warm chocolate brown for his body. His top hat and bow tie look great in black with a pop of color — try deep red or purple for the bow tie. Use bright, bold colors for the balloons: red, yellow, blue, and green all work well. The carnival tents look fun in red and white stripes. Add yellow and orange to the lights to make them glow. Use pink and white for the popcorn. For the banners and confetti, go wild with as many colors as you like. The more colorful, the more festive the scene will feel!
Coloring challenges: Which parts are difficult to color and need attention for Freddy Fazbear At Carnival coloring page?
• Freddy's fur texture: Freddy has a layered, textured fur coat that can be tricky to color evenly. You may want to use short, light strokes to build up the brown tones gradually. Blending a darker shade along the edges helps give his body a rounded, three-dimensional look.
• Small details on clothing: His top hat, bow tie, and buttons are small and close together. Staying inside the lines in these tight areas requires a fine-tipped marker or a sharpened colored pencil. Take your time and work slowly around each detail.
• Carnival background complexity: The background is packed with tents, lights, banners, and booths. Each element has its own shape and color zone. It can be easy to accidentally color over a border. Lightly sketching which color goes where before you start can help you stay organized.
• Lighting and glow effects: The carnival lights in the background create a warm glow. Recreating this effect with colored pencils or crayons takes some layering. Try using yellow at the center of each light and blending outward into orange, then leaving the surrounding area lighter.
• Balancing bold and soft colors: Freddy's warm brown tones need to stand out against the bright carnival colors behind him. If the background becomes too vivid, Freddy can get lost in the scene. Keep his fur slightly muted compared to the background to maintain a clear focal point.
